THEORY

Essay Writing

Answer two questions in all: one question from each section. Each composition should contain at least 200 words Credit will be given for clarity of expression and orderly presentation of material

Question 1

Write a letter to your Assemblyman suggesting three ways in which you can help improve sanitation in your area.

Question 2

Write a letter to your brother living in another region of your country informing him about the latest news at home.

Question 3

You are a speaker in an inter-school debate on the topic: Television is doing more harm than good to students. Write your speech for or against the topic.

Question 4

our PTA has introduced a Best Teacher Award Scheme for your school. Which of your teachers would you nominate for the award and why?
